| 正面描述 | Central field dominated by the Jochid tamgha, a stylized trident-like dynastic emblem rendered in bold relief, flanked by six-pointed star ornaments serving as decorative space fillers. The entire composition is enclosed within an octagram (eight-pointed star) formed by two overlapping squares, whose interstice points frame the central device. The overall design is geometric and non-figural, consistent with early Golden Horde anonymous coinage, with the tamgha acting as the primary symbol of dynastic authority in place of a ruler's name. |

| 背面描述 | Bold Arabic mint formula in stylized script occupying the central field, reading 'darb Bulghar' (struck at Bulghar), identifying the mint city on the Volga. Above the main inscription, a curvilinear floral or vegetal arabesque pattern serves as a decorative element. The lettering is executed in a robust, somewhat angular hand characteristic of early Golden Horde coinage, with the individual letter forms heavily stylized and intertwined. The field is otherwise plain, with no border legend or additional ornamental devices visible. |
